Compass Group Plc is a £20 billion turnover, global organisation and the world's leading provider of food and support services. With operations across seven key business areas (Foodservice; Support Services; Business & Industry; Healthcare & Seniors; Education; Sports & Leisure; and Defence, Offshore & Remote), Compass serves customers in offices and factories; schools and universities; hospitals.

How to prepare for a job interview at Compass
✨Know Your Culinary Skills
Make sure you brush up on your culinary techniques and be ready to discuss your experience in the kitchen. Compass Group Plc values expertise, so be prepared to share specific examples of dishes you've created or challenges you've overcome in previous roles.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research Compass Group Plc and its various sectors. Understanding their commitment to quality food and service will help you align your answers with their values. Show that you’re not just a great chef but also a good fit for their team.
✨Prepare for Practical Questions
Expect questions about how you handle pressure, manage kitchen staff, and ensure food safety. Think of scenarios from your past experiences where you demonstrated leadership and problem-solving skills, as these are crucial in a fast-paced environment.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ready. Inquire about the team you'll be working with or the types of cuisines they focus on.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
